Job description
Job Summary

The Corporate Procurement Manager will play a pivotal role in managing the procurement process, ensuring the organization acquires quality goods and services at competitive prices. This position requires strategic thinking, strong negotiation skills, and the ability to foster relationships with suppliers while aligning with the company's overall goals and objectives.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and implement procurement strategies that align with the company's objectives.
  • Manage supplier relationships and negotiate contracts to secure favorable terms.
  • Conduct market research and analyze trends to identify potential suppliers and products.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to understand procurement needs and develop sourcing plans.
  • Monitor and evaluate supplier performance and implement improvement initiatives as necessary.
  • Ensure compliance with procurement policies and procedures.
